About

We're a Free Deep Financial Literacy and Emotional Well-Being After-School Program for At-Risk Youth (10th-12th graders). 


The Program Includes:

- Feeding kids a healthy filling meal (many of our students experience food insecurity)

- Showing students how to care for their mental and emotional well-being through scientifically proven techniques to elevate their emotional state in the moment, become aware of, and release accumulated stress so they feel better and think more clearly.

- Showing students what's possible for them in their lives. Helping them set and achieve goals.

- Helping students make their first $1,000, by showing them how to find a need, fill a need, get paid for it, and then repeat the process. We also help students understand money mindset and how to up-level it by identifying and clearing their money blocks and being comfortable handling money, asking for money, and having money.

- Getting students banked - their first checking and savings accounts set up.

- Teaching deep financial literacy - how to make, save, protect, and invest money.

- Career counseling and resources.
